History of the Waldenses succinctly describes the conflicts the Waldensians were engaged in and the martyrdoms they endured in defense of their faith and liberty. Wylie’s fast-paced work shows how a large measure of constitutional liberty and freedom of conscience now enjoyed by Italy was due in large part to the efforts of the Waldensians.

James Aitken Wylie (1808–1890) was educated at Marischal College, University of Aberdeen, before studying at the University of St. Andrews under Thomas Chalmers. Wylie was the editor for the Free Church Record for eight years, and authored numerous books, including The Awakening of Italy and the Crisis of Rome, The History of Protestantism, and The Papacy: Its History, Dogmas, Genius, and Prospects.
